corruption; graft; bribery in public office
Dishonest or illegal conduct by government officials or public servants, especially involving bribery or abuse of power for personal gain.
汚職で逮捕された。
He was arrested for corruption.
市長の汚職スキャンダルが報道された。
The mayor's corruption scandal was reported in the news.
政府は汚職防止のための新しい法律を制定した。
The government enacted a new law to prevent corruption.
USAGE:
A compound of 汚 (dirty, corrupt) and 職 (position, office). Specifically refers to corruption in public office — misuse of governmental authority for personal gain. For corporate corruption, 不正 is more commonly used.
COMMON COLLOCATIONS:
- 汚職スキャンダル (corruption scandal)
- 汚職事件 (corruption case)
- 汚職防止 (corruption prevention)
- 汚職に手を染める (to get involved in corruption)
SIMILAR WORDS:
- 賄賂: bribery — the act of giving or receiving bribes, a specific form of 汚職
- 不正: fraud, irregularity — broader term covering dishonest acts in any context
